0、二进制单位
计算机中存储数据和计算数据都是基于二进制(二进制补码)来做的
二进制位 : bit 比特位 仅存储一位二进制 0 或 1
基本数据类型 : Byte 字节 1 Byte = 8 bit;
KB 1 KB = 1024 Byte;
MB 1 MB = 1024 KB;
GB 1 GB = 1024 MB;
TB 1 TB = 1024 GB;
PB 1 PB = 1024 TB;
1、码表
1、码表 : 用来存储字符和对应的数字的映射关系
2、常见码表 :
① ASCII 码表/ ISO8859-1 码表 : 1个字符占用1个字节
ASCII 码表取值范围 0~127
ISO8859-1 码表取值范围 0~255
eg : A – 65 a – 97
② GB2312 码表 :1个字符占用2个字节
特点 :新增常用的中文汉字; 兼容 ASCII 码表
③ GBK : 1个字符占用2个字节
GBK ------ 国标码
④ Unicode 编码规则 :
特点 :涵盖了世界范围内所有国家常用的字符; 只是规定了字符和数字之间的映射关系,但是并没有指定存储的单位
⑤ UTF-16 / UTF-32 :
特点 :